Introduction: The Language of Flowers
The tradition of interpreting flowers as representations of inner feelings dates back centuries, from ancient Greece to the Victorian era's "floriography." Your affinity for particular blossoms isn't just about looks; it's a reflection of your soul, dreams, and emotional needs. When you connect with the right flower, you can find inspiration, healing, and deeper self-understanding.

Flower Meanings Around the World
The symbolism of flowers is a universal language, but interpretations often vary by culture. Understanding this global perspective brings additional depth to your journey of self-discovery:
- Cherry Blossoms represent the fleeting beauty of life in Japanese culture.
- Lotus symbolizes spiritual rebirth and purity in Buddhism and Hinduism.
- Marigold stands for resilience and dedication in Mexican Day of the Dead traditions.
